VakifBank Triumphs Over Milano, Advances to Champions League Final Four

VakifBank has secured their berth in the CEV Champions League Final Four by defeating Numia Vero Volley Milano in a gripping five-set quarterfinal match played on their home ground.

With the passionate support of 2,850 fans at VakifBank Spor Sarayı, the Turkish club demonstrated remarkable resilience and composure to clinch a hard-fought 3-2 victory.

VakifBank started strong, confidently winning the opening set. However, Milano quickly equalized the match. The home team regained momentum in the third set, but the Italian challengers rallied once more, pushing the contest to a decisive tie-break after a fiercely fought fourth set.

In the crucial final set, VakifBank maintained their composure under pressure, seizing pivotal opportunities to pull ahead in the late stages and ultimately secure the win.

Marina Markova spearheaded VakifBank’s offense, securing an impressive 23 points, which matched the output of Milano’s formidable Paola Egonu. Another significant contributor for VakifBank added 17 points.

This triumph marks VakifBank’s return to the Final Four, where they will aim to continue their quest for yet another Champions League title, cheered on by their home fans in Istanbul.

Match Result:

VakifBank Istanbul (TUR) def. Numia Vero Volley Milano (ITA) 3-2 (25-22, 16-25, 25-16, 23-25, 15-12)
